Good educational video Endfloat. I ripped out my Electrolux RM212 series fridge, not because it was a shit fridge ( it was and still is a good fridge) but because I have done away with LPG in my van. I do have a new compressor fridge and can justify the cost and it will run on solar power alone and it will cool stuff to -22 decrees C in a matter of minutes. it will not flatten my battery ever, uses 0.4ah/h, now back to the 212. Heres the science why turning the fridge upside down for a day may get it working again. The coolant in the fridge crystalises at the top of the circuit when the fridge has not been switched on over a period of time. Turning it over allows the liquid refrigerant to glug its way through the pipe circuit disolving those crystals. Turned upright the next day, the refrigerant glugs its way back to the resevoir at the bottom taking the now disolved crystals with it. Worked for me after the van was stood for 8 years, fridge has worked perfectly for 5 years since that time. now, on earlier 212 fridges the igniter for the gas didn't require a 12v supply, it was a piezzo ignition. it worked but was a fucker pushing the button 20 times to get it to light :-) The 12v supply was ( an still is) to keep the fridge cold while the engine is running, this overrides the thermostat and just keeps it cool. it also draws 12ah/h These fridges also stop operating if the van is out of level by as little as 3 degrees. make sure your van is level when you are camped out. These fridges cannot cool anything more than 20 degrees C below ambient temperature. Great fridge in Norway, fecking useless in Morocco. Hope some of that helps.
